This was a spectacular example of aggression back-firing. The usual results at a recent Swiss Pairs event were either 5♣ by EW or 5 by NS doubled but only down one. Only one EW reached 6♣, when an adventurous South decided to open with a Weak 2! West bid 3♣ and North jumped straight to 5, leaving East little option but to bid 6♣.
